TATSULOK
On the other hand, the song "Tatsulok" addresses the country's
poverty as a primary cause of armed conflict. This is a reference
to the social pyramid hierarchy, in which persons with a higher
social status are at the top and those with a lower social status
are at the bottom. The song demonstrates that while a few elites
continue to live in luxury, most people continue to live in
poverty. Another clear message conveyed by the song is that our
justice system in the Philippines is skewed and in favor of those
in positions that have power and wealth. Our country's problem will
not improve as long as we do not demonstrate sufficient respect and
treatment for one another. If such discrimination against the poor
persists, anarchy would ultimately emerge due to flagrant
violations of human rights.
